As we prepare for the start of Black History month in two weeks, take a look at Oh Freedom! The Story of the Underground Railroad at Howard Conn Fine Arts Center. The Underground Railroad one of the greatest collaborations against racism in American history. Through this productions you and your family can learn about the lives of the major players, including Harriet Tubman and Harriet Beecher Stowe, through stories and songs of the period. You’ll also hear about the lesser-known heroes, like mysterious “Peg Leg” Joe, who taught slaves to escape, and Henry “Box” Brown, who had himself put in a box and mailed to freedom. Relive the journey at Youth Performance Company’s Black History Month production at Minneapolis’ Howard Conn Fine Arts Center.
